What is the recommended temperature range for storing library and archival materials?

  1. 65-75°F (18-24°C)

  2. 50-60°F (10-16°C)

  3. 75-85°F (24-29°C)

  4. 40-50°F (4-10°C)

Reveal answer Fill a bubble to check yourself
A Correct answer
Explanation

The ideal temperature range for storing library and archival materials is 65-75°F (18-24°C), as this range minimizes the risk of damage caused by temperature fluctuations.

What is the recommended relative humidity range for storing library and archival materials?

  1. 30-40%

  2. 45-55%

  3. 60-70%

  4. 75-85%

Reveal answer Fill a bubble to check yourself
B Correct answer
Explanation

The ideal relative humidity range for storing library and archival materials is 45-55%, as this range minimizes the risk of damage caused by humidity fluctuations.

What is the recommended cooking temperature for poultry to ensure its safety?

  1. 165°F (74°C) or above

  2. 145°F (63°C) or above

  3. 125°F (52°C) or above

  4. 100°F (38°C) or above

Reveal answer Fill a bubble to check yourself
A Correct answer
Explanation

Poultry should be cooked to an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C) or above to ensure its safety and eliminate harmful bacteria.
